EPR Plasmid #432: Tol2(HSE:zcaspb-GFP_cmlc2:tagRFP)
Purpose of plasmid Expression of zebrafish GFP tagged caspb under heatshock promter, Tol2 based genome integration
Depositing Lab Maria Leptin
European Molecular Biology Laboratory (EMBL)
Depositing Scientist Eva Hasel de Carvalho
Antibiotic Resistance Ampicillin
Bacterial Growth Temp 37
Copy Number High
Selectable Marker
Reference Dynamics of in vivo ASC speck formation.
Kuri P et al. J Cell Biol 2017
